The next step is to conduct a more in-depth analysis and assess the degree of influence of the events selected in the previous step. For this, various risk management tools are used in the project, but most often a heat matrix is created. With its help, you can assess the level of influence of a particular threat on the work process.
To do this, draw a table with two axes: the Y axis is the probability of an event occurring, and the X axis is the degree of impact of the event. Then, the selected problems are entered into the cells of the table, they are assessed, and the cells are colored in accordance with their level of criticality.

Let's look at the construction of the matrix using the example of creating a mobile application. Step by step, this process will look like this.
1. Assessing the probability and impact. To develop a heat matrix, each threat is assessed. The assessment can be done in percentage or qualitative terms: low, medium, high criticality.
Difficulties with the application interface. Probability: 70%, impact: significant.
Lack of developers and testers at the development stage. Probability: 30%, medium, impact: significant.
Data leaks or poor protection of user information. Probability: 60%, high, impact: significant.
2. Create a heat matrix. Once all threats have been assessed for probability and impact, they need to be plotted on a heat matrix. The Y axis will represent probability, and the X axis will represent impact.

3. Analysis and prioritization. Using color zones, we determine the priority risks in the project. The methods for managing them will need to be determined in the next step.
